Dungeons & Dragons is a massively popular game that continues to grow year over year. While there are online tools for Dungeons & Dragons in the modern era, many players still love the traditional tabletop roleplaying experience. However you play, there are plenty of D&D books, cards, kits and more that can add to your gaming experience. The Player’s Handbook is our favorite starter book, because it’s essentially a one-stop shop for the basic rules, basic spells and how to start a campaign. It will guide you through character creation and it includes a section for Game Masters — and right now it’s 48% off.

This Core Rulebook comes with over 150 monsters that are ready for play, including goblins, dragons and other creatures. Budding and experienced Dungeon Masters alike can find over 400 stat blocks with all the information they’ll need to run encounters and make world building easier, and players can learn more about the enemies they might run into during a campaign. Sure, you might have the Monster Manual from the sale above, but looking through every monster to find the ones you’re using in combat can be slow. These cards let you have the monsters you need laid out behind your GM screen, so you can easily track their stats, resistances and hit points.

This collection will help you run a game across the Planes, providing you with a book full of new rules and best practices, a book outlining the many creatures you’re likely to run into when you wander too far from home, and a campaign book with a compelling story to help outline this broader set of worlds to explore, as well as some tools the DM will find particularly useful.

If you’re looking for a space-based campaign, this is your go-to collection. With an adventure book, a setting book, a book of monsters, a poster map and a DM screen, this pack has everything you need to run a campaign set in the starlit realms of Wildspace and the Astral Sea, along with tools for players who want to build characters from these realms.
